Pete Davidson Unveils Shocking Mobster Transformation on Tommy Karate Set

Pete Davidson turned heads on the set of his upcoming crime thriller ‘Tommy Karate‘ in Brooklyn, N.Y., on Aug. 25, looking almost unrecognizable.

The comedian and actor was photographed with piercing blue contact lenses and long, dark hair, a far cry from his usual clean-cut appearance.

Davidson is taking on the role of Tommy Pitera, a real-life mobster known for his brutal methods and feared reputation in the underworld.

The transformation is striking. The blue eyes are especially jarring, giving him an icy, menacing look that suits the character.

Fans and onlookers were quick to share images on social media, marveling at the dramatic change.

This role marks a significant departure for Davidson, who is best known for his comedy work on ‘Saturday Night Live’ and in films like ‘The King of Staten Island.’

‘Tommy Karate’ is a crime thriller that has been generating buzz since its announcement, and Davidson’s commitment to the part is already turning it into a must-see.

The production is taking place in Brooklyn, which adds an authentic gritty backdrop to the story.
